How many FPs should I get for 1875 FE goods. I have done it for 300FP in the past for 1:1 goods trades of different ages.

However many you can negotiate. There is no universally agreed on ratio of FP to goods, and what may be the going ratio in one world may not be the going ratio in another.
 

DeletedUser10415

Whatever they think is a good deal is a good deal for them. As an example of the variability of these deals, I'll say that I have gotten 3 FE goods per FP, and on the same world from another player later on I've gotten 4 FE goods per FP. After I got the deal for 4, I didn't bother further with the one offering 3. In other worlds I've gotten anywhere from 3-5 PE goods per FP. It's really down to what you're willing to pay in goods and what the FP contributor is willing to take for their FP.

I would personally be quite fine with paying that number, works out to 6.25/fp. But what's important is your market. Are you one of the only sources of FE goods around? Then you might be short changing yourself a bit. Are they a guildie and it's an arc which helps the guild? Then maybe it's fine to be more giving. I was doing multiple trades for TE goods at 5/FP and everyone was happy with this number. The few amount of people still in the era or with left over goods (so I didn't have to delete half my friends list) meant I wasn't going to shop around I was perfectly happy offering a bit more to get goods from what to me was a limited resource pool.
